Westphalia: The Last Christian Peace
Somehow, the English-speaking world went over 350 years without a monograph on a peace treaty that is acknowledged as one of the most important in history. For more information, go to this page.
Amazon rating: 4.5 “It provides a detailed but comprehensible account of the Westphalia negotiations” (Journal of Modern History)
“Here is everything one might want to know about the Peace of Westphalia” (Choice)
The Peace of Westphalia: A Historical Dictionary
If you need to know something about one particular aspect of the peace — a country, an issue, an ambassador, or something general such as “public” or “newspapers” — this is a good place to look.
Amazon rating: 4.8 “[a]n indispensable aid to anglophone scholars” (International History Review)
Peacemaking in Early Modern Europe: Cardinal Mazarin and the Congress of Westphalia, 1643-1648
More detailed than the other two books listed here. It is especially useful for its discussion of military campaigns and their relation to the negotiations.
